Septic induced abortion.
Professional Med J Jan ;8(4):460-64.

Thirty patients with induced abortion leading to generalized peritonitis and acute renal failure were admitted in the department of Gynae & Obst over the period of 3 years i.e. from January 1995 - December 1997. All patients were admitted in emergency. Most common presenting symptoms were high grade fever, abdominal pain, oliguria, bleeding per vaginum, foul smelling pussy discharge per vaginum after the history of D & C from Dai (TBA). Out of 32 patients, 2 patients died after laparotomy and the maternal mortality was found to be 6.25%.
